Ingredients with Measurements

  • 🥐 1 sheet puff pastry (about 250g)
  • 🍫 100g Kinder chocolate (or similar milk chocolate)
  • 🥚 1 egg
  • 🥛 A splash of milk

Step-by-Step Instructions: How to Make Easy Kinder Chocolate Croissants

Preparation

  1. Preheat your oven: Set it to 200°C (392°F)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per to prevent sticking.
  2. Prepare the puff pastry: Lightly flour your work surface and roll out the puff pastry sheet if needed to smooth it out. Cut the pastry into triangles—about 4-6 per sheet depending on size.

Filling & Rolling

  1. Place the chocolate: Put a piece of Kinder chocolate at the wide end of each triangle. Be careful not to overfill to prevent leakage during baking.
  2. Roll the croissants: Starting from the wide end, gently roll up each triangle towards the tip, encasing the chocolate inside. Slightly pinch the edges to seal if needed.

Egg Wash & Baking

  1. Prepare the egg wash: Beat the egg with a splash of milk until combined.
  2. Brush the croissants: Lightly brush the tops and sides of each croissant with the egg wash. This gives them a beautiful golden color and a shiny finish.
  3. Bake: Arrange the croissants on the prepared baking sheet and bake for approximately 20 minutes, or until they are golden brown and flaky.

Cooling & Serving

  1. Let cool slightly: Allow the croissants to cool for a few minutes before serving to prevent burns and to let the chocolate set slightly.
  2. Enjoy: Serve warm or at room temperature for the ultimate chocolate-filled pastry experience.

How to Store & How Long It Lasts

To keep your Easy Kinder Chocolate Croissants fresh:

  • Room temperature: Store in an airtight container for up to 1 day. Reheat briefly in the oven or microwave for a fresh taste.
  • Refrigeration: Keep in an airtight container for up to 2 days. Reheat in the oven at 180°C (356°F) for 5-7 minutes to restore crispiness.
  • Freezing: Wrap individually in plastic wrap and store in a freezer-safe bag for up to 1 month. Thaw at room temperature and reheat in the oven before serving.

FAQs About Easy Kinder Chocolate Croissants

  1. Can I use other types of chocolate? Yes! Feel free to substitute Kinder chocolate with your favorite milk, dark, or white chocolate bars.
  2. Can I make these ahead of time? Yes, you can prepare the croissants up to the baking stage, then refrigerate or freeze them. Bake fresh when ready to serve.
  3. Can I use frozen puff pastry? Absolutely! Just thaw it according to package instructions before using.
  4. How do I prevent the chocolate from leaking during baking? Make sure to seal the edges well and don’t overfill the croissants.
  5. Can I make these vegan? Yes! Use vegan puff pastry and vegan chocolate to make a plant-based version.
  6. Are these suitable for kids? Definitely! They’re a fun, sweet treat loved by children and adults alike.
  7. Can I add toppings like nuts or sprinkles? Yes! Sprinkle chopped nuts or colorful sprinkles on top before baking for extra texture and fun.
  8. What’s the best way to reheat leftovers? Reheat in a preheated oven at 180°C (356°F) for 5-7 minutes to keep them crispy.
  9. Can I make a larger batch? Of course! Just multiply the ingredients accordingly and keep an eye on baking time, which may need slight adjustment.
  10. Is this recipe suitable for gluten-free diets? Not as is. Use gluten-free puff pastry to make it suitable for gluten-sensitive individuals.
